CLI Standards Skill

Purpose

Use this skill to keep a CLI predictable, script-friendly, and human-friendly.

Non-negotiable defaults

  1. Options before operands by default.
  2. Support -h and --help; both must show help and exit successfully.
  3. Support --version; print version information to stdout and exit successfully.
  4. Primary output to stdout; diagnostics/errors/progress to stderr.
  5. Exit code 0 for success, non-zero for failure.
  6. Support -- to end option parsing when operands may start with -.
  7. Avoid breaking existing flags/subcommands; prefer additive changes.

Design workflow

Step 1: Command model

  • Prefer explicit subcommands for complex workflows.
  • Keep naming consistent across subcommands.
  • Avoid ambiguous command names (update vs upgrade) unless clearly distinct.

Step 2: Args and Flags

  • Prefer flags over too many positional args.
  • Provide both short and long forms for high-frequency options.
  • Use standard names where possible:
    • -h, --help
    • --version
    • -v/--verbose (pick one semantics and stay consistent)
    • -q, --quiet
    • -n, --dry-run
    • -f, --force
    • -o, --output
  • In script examples, use fully spelled-out long option names.

Step 3: Output Contract

  • Human-readable default output.
  • If machine integration is needed, provide --json (or an equivalent stable format).
  • Do not mix parseable data with log lines on stdout.
  • If output is long, use a pager only for interactive TTY.

Step 4: Errors and UX

  • Error messages should be actionable: what failed + why + next fix.
  • If a typo is likely, suggest the closest command or flag.
  • For destructive actions, confirm in interactive mode; require an explicit force/confirm flag in non-interactive mode.
  • Never require prompts in CI or script mode.

Step 5: Compatibility and Evolution

  • Keep existing behavior stable unless a major version migration is explicit.
  • If deprecating, warn clearly and provide a replacement path.
  • Preserve automation paths (--no-input, --json, stable exit semantics).

Priority when standards conflict

  1. Project-specific compatibility requirements (existing CLI contract)
  2. POSIX conventions (syntax/order/disambiguation baseline)
  3. GNU conventions (--help, --version, long options)
  4. Git CLI and CLIG practices (usability/script robustness)
